Different Doping Levels High Optical Quality Nd:YAG Laser Crystals For High Power Laser​

Products Description:

Undoped YAG Laser Crystal is an excellent material for UV-IR Optical Windows, particularly for high temperature and high energy density application. It's different from Nd:YAG Crystal.

The mechanical and chemical stability is comparable to sapphire crystal, but YAG is unique with non-birefringence and available with higher optical homogeneity and surface quality.

Up to 3" YAG boule grown by CZ method, as-cut blocks, windows and mirrors are available.

Advantages of Undoped YAG:

  • High thermal conductivity, 10 times better than glasses
  • Extremely hard and durable
  • Non-birefringence
  • Stable mechanical and chemical properties
  • High bulk damage threshold
  • High index of refraction, facilitating low aberration lens design
  • Features of Undoped YAG
  • Transmission in 0.25-5.0 mm, no absorption in 2-3 mm
  • High thermal conductivity
  • High index of refraction and Non-birefringence

Basic properties of Undoped YAG:

  • Density 4.5g/cm3
  • Transmission Range 250-5000nm
  • Melting Point 1970°C
  • Specific Heat 0.59 W.s/g/K
  • Thermal Conductivity 14 W/m/K
  • Thermal Shock Resistance 790 W/m
  • Thermal Expansion 6.9x10-6/K; dn/dt, at 633nm 7.3x10-6/K-1
  • Mohs Hardness 8.5
  • Refractive Index 1.8245 at 0.8mm, 1.8197 at 1.0mm, 1.8121 at 1.4mm
